The interview process was fast and to the point. We talked about actual use cases, and I got to chat with many people from different parts of the company. We started by going over specific use cases, then we dove into the details of my resume. Later on, I did a simple coding test and talked about processes with some of the team members.
I applied via LinkedIn and a recruiter. First, there was a recruiter call, then I talked to marketing folks. After that, I had 1:1s with behavioral and process questions. They also went over the job description, goals, and my expectations. The second part, over the phone, involved a 3-min slide deck presentation pitching a hypothetical inbound prospect using sample info they gave me. They looked at my flow, demeanor, and objection handling. HR and the hiring manager called a few days later to discuss the offer, but I took another job closer to home.
